Actions to Obtain an Austrian Driver's License
The procedure of obtaining a driver's license in Austria can be broken down into numerous key actions:
Step 1: Enroll in a Driving School
Potential motorists should first enroll in an acknowledged driving school. This organization will offer the essential theoretical and practical training needed to pass the driving evaluation.
Step 2: Complete Theoretical Training
A thorough understanding of traffic rules, policies, and safe driving practices is important. This training often consists of classroom direction and computer-based learning.
Step 3: Pass Theoretical Exam
After completing the theoretical training, candidates should pass a composed exam. This test tests understanding of roadway signs, traffic guidelines, and legal commitments.
Step 4: Practical Driving Lessons

Step 5: Pass Practical Driving Test
Upon completion of the needed useful lessons, prospects need to take a driving test in real-world conditions. Successful completion shows the prospect's ability to operate a vehicle safely.
Action 6: Apply for the License
After passing both the theoretical and practical exams, prospects can get their driver's license at the appropriate authority. Essential documents (consisting of identification and proof of residency) need to be sent along with the application.
Step 7: Receive the Driver's License
As soon as the application is processed, individuals will receive their driver's license, enabling them to legally drive in Austria.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)Q1: Can I utilize my foreign driver's license in Austria?
A1: Yes, foreign driver's licenses are legitimate in Austria for a limited period, typically as much as six months. After this duration, individuals should get an Austrian driver's license.
Q2: What is the cost of acquiring an Austrian driver's license?
A2: The expense varies depending on the driving school, however candidates should anticipate to budget plan for lessons, exams, and administrative costs, which can total around EUR1,500 to EUR3,000.
Q3: How long does it take to get a driver's license in Austria?
A3: The timeline depends on private development however normally ranges from a few months to over a year, factoring in training, tests, and paperwork processing.
Q4: Are there any exemptions for driving tests?
A4: Yes, specific individuals, such as those holding a comparable EU license, may be exempt from retaking tests, but they must still look for an Austrian license.
Q5: What do I do if I lose my driver's license?
